In England the GPs have the legal right to send adults to an ADHD assessment with any provider they prefer, as long as the provider is registered as doing NHS assessments in their region. This is called Right to Choose, and it can reduce waiting times for assessments. However, the GP must still approve of the referral.

The NHS is currently in a state crisis and the investment in adult ADHD services has been cut by more than PS70 million since 2009. The psychiatrists' rotas that assess adults are full, and there is a massive gap between the demand and capacity. This has led to the proliferation of shortcuts, from online assessments to fraudulent methods like those on Panorama.
